Rex-Royal faults we diagnose

Common Rex-Royal issues we fix in Oakville.

Every issue below comes with a description of what causes it and what we do to resolve it. If yours isn't listed, call us anyway.

Water, boiler & heating 4 issues
!

Slow heating or hot-water output dropping under load

Scale insulating the heating element is the leading cause on untreated water, followed by element fatigue. We descale the circuit, test element resistance against spec, replace the element if output doesn't recover, and benchmark heat-up and hot-water throughput before reassembly.

!

Boiler temperature fault or heating timeout

A failed temperature sensor, a degraded element, or a relay sticking on the control board stops the boiler reaching setpoint inside the warm-up window. We test the sensor resistance against the reference table, check element resistance, inspect the relay, replace the faulty part, and clear the fault.

!

Water under the machine or in the drip tray

A weeping fitting, a worn brew-unit or hydraulic seal, or a blocked drain causing overflow. We pressure-test the circuits, dye-trace the chassis to the exact leak point, clear any drain blockage, and replace the failed seal or fitting rather than just retighten it.

!

Autofill running constantly or water-fill fault

A scaled level probe, a fill solenoid leaking past, a restricted supply, or an exhausted filter cartridge. We descale or replace the probe, test the solenoid, check upstream filtration, and confirm the fill cycle completes correctly.

Milk & steam 3 issues
!

Fresh-milk system producing weak or no foam

Milk residue narrows the foam chamber and the air-intake line, so the foam thins or collapses. We strip and sanitise the milk circuit, replace worn O-rings and the air-intake parts, test the milk pump draw, and verify foam quality across the drink menu before leaving.

!

Milk dispensing cold or lukewarm

Usually a milk-temperature sensor out of spec or scale in the milk-side heat path. We test the sensor against a reference probe, descale the milk circuit, and replace the sensor if it reads out of spec. Most cases are a one-visit fix.

!

Sour smell or off-taste in milk drinks

A clear sign the daily milk clean has been skipped or the cleaning agent is exhausted. We deep-clean and sanitise the whole milk pathway, replace stained milk lines, and walk the staff through the daily cycle so it doesn't come back.

Electronics, grinder & other 7 issues
!

Grinder dose drift or inconsistent drink volume

Burr wear is the usual cause, with calibration drift behind it. On the twin-grinder S300 and the up-to-three-grinder S500 one grinder often wears faster than the others. We weigh dose per grinder across a run of shots, measure the burr gap, recalibrate each side, and replace burrs that are past spec.

!

Grinder rattle or not feeding beans

A small stone or other foreign object riding in with the beans, beans bridging above the throat, or a stuck hopper gate. We open the grinder, clear the obstruction, inspect the burrs for chips, replace them if damaged, and confirm the hopper feeds consistently.

!

Touchscreen frozen or controls unresponsive

On the touchscreen S300 and S500 this is usually a firmware hang rather than dead hardware. We run a controlled reset, check the firmware version, reflash from a known-good image if it sticks, and replace the display module only when the touch panel itself has failed.

!

Error code on the display that won't clear

We read the full fault log through the service interface, pin down whether the root cause is a sensor, valve, motor, or board, replace the specific failed component, and clear the log. Most error codes resolve in a single visit.

!

Grounds drawer or waste fault stopping the machine

A grounds drawer not seated, a full-drawer sensor misreading, or a blocked drainage path will lock out brewing. We check the drawer sensor, clear the drainage, and replace the sensor if it reads unreliably so the machine stops false-stopping mid-service.

!

Cleaning cycle interrupted or won't complete

A level sensor in the cleaning circuit misreading, a blockage in the cleaning path, or the wrong cleaning tablet dosing. We diagnose where the cycle stalls, clear the circuit, verify the dosing, and watch a full cycle complete before we sign off.

!

Older Rex-Royal machine needing discontinued parts

We keep older Rex-Royal machines running after other shops have given up. For parts no longer in production we source from refurbisher networks, salvage from decommissioned units, and use validated aftermarket equivalents where the quality matches. When a repair stops making sense against the machine's value, we tell you straight.

Brew system & pressure 2 issues
!

Brew unit jamming or stuck mid-cycle

The metal brewing unit stalls on packed grounds, a swollen seal, or a worn gearmotor after high-volume use. We strip the brew unit, clear the chamber, replace the seals and any worn cam or drive part, lubricate with food-safe grease, and verify clean cycling before the machine goes back on the counter.

!

Coffee grounds in the cup or weak extraction

A torn brew screen, a worn piston seal, or grind drifting too fine lets grounds through and flattens the shot. We inspect the brew unit, replace worn screens and seals, measure brew pressure, and recalibrate the grind and dose to bring extraction back to spec.

What Oakville water means for your Rex-Royal.

Moderate, 125 to 145 mg/L CaCO3 typical from the Region of Halton supply (Lake Ontario sourced). Comparable to Toronto and Mississauga, slightly higher in north Oakville. Standard inline filtration plus 3 to 4 month descale intervals work for most Oakville installs.

When is replacing the machine cheaper than repairing it?

When repair cost passes roughly 50% of a refurbished replacement, or when multiple major systems are failing on a machine past 8 to 10 years of heavy use. We give you honest math on this. We'd rather lose the repair than fix something that'll break again next month.
